Bank Info for NB Charter 4669 (1891 - 1923)

Official Bank Title(s) (Huntoon)
# Bank Title (Change Date) Bank Town
1 The First National Bank of
Wells, MN
Bank Officer Pairs (OCC/Pollock)
Years Cashier President
1892-1893 John Henry Joice Peter Morton Joice
1894-1895 John Henry Joice A. L. Taylor
1896-1902 Albert Oscar Oleson M. J. Pihl
1903-1913 Calvin Hiram Draper M. J. Pihl
1914-1922 Geo. L. Schmitz Calvin Hiram Draper
1923-1923 Geo. L. Schmitz E. A. Siddall

Bank History Summary (VanBelkum/Huntoon/Pollock)
  • Organized Dec 12, 1891
  • Chartered Dec 22, 1891
  • Succeeded Citizens Bank
  • Receivership Oct 22, 1923
